A good solar installer does more than offer equipment. They examine your roofing honestly, design manufacturing conservatively, navigate permits, coordinate utility interconnection, and see to it the electric job is tidy and safe. The best solar installers Danville citizens pick tend to be the firms that manage tiny information well, because tiny details end up being huge issues once the panels are already on the roof.
Most house owners start with item inquiries. Which panel is ideal? Is one inverter brand name far better than one more? Should I add a battery currently or later?
Those are reasonable inquiries, yet they follow the bigger problem: system style and implementation. A costs panel set up on the incorrect roof plane or coupled with sloppy circuitry is not a costs system. On the other hand, a mid to top tier panel with sound format job, appropriate obstacles, exact shading analysis, and a responsive service team usually does precisely as it must for years.
Solar is not a single acquisition. It is a sequence of decisions. Site evaluation, design, funding, agreement language, permits, setup, assessment, PTO from the utility, and future service all impact the last value. The installer touches every step.
That is why the most inexpensive quote is not constantly the least costly alternative in method. A reduced bid can conceal weak presumptions regarding annual manufacturing, impractical organizing, or slim post-install assistance. If a business vanishes, subcontracts everything without oversight, or drags out adjustment job, the cost savings vanish quickly.
Solar propositions must never look the same from home to house. Danville residential properties usually differ in roofing system pitch, mature landscape design, architectural design, and readily available southern, southwest, or west-facing roofing system space. Some homes have broad warm areas that make solar simple. Others have dormers, chimneys, vents, or tree shielding that pressure tighter design choices.
That is where seasoned neighborhood judgment appears. A strong installer can tell you when a roof covering is solar-friendly, when cutting trees would materially boost result, and when the very best economic step is to mount less panels in much better settings as opposed to loading every available surface.
Local code and energy processes additionally matter. The specific timeline for approval depends on permit review, examination organizing, and utility interconnection requirements. Installers who routinely work in the location generally comprehend those actions far better than a remote sales operation that deals with every city the very same. A great proposal really feels certain. It ought to reflect your house, your electric use, and your goals. If it reads like a common template with your address pasted in, that is a caution sign.
At a minimum, the proposal ought to clarify how many panels are being set up, where they are going, what equipment is consisted of, what estimated production resembles, and what assumptions drive the cost savings projection. If there is funding, the installer should separate system price from financing price so you can see what you are really spending for the tools and labor.
The much better propositions also resolve what occurs if conditions change. As an example, if the roof covering decking requirements repair work after panel removal areas are revealed, who handles that? If the main circuit box needs upgrades to support solar, is that included or noted as an allowance? If a battery is not consisted of now, can the system suit one later on without significant redesign?
A proposition worth relying on typically sounds a little less fancy and a bit extra concrete. That is an excellent thing.

Homeowners understandably focus on the complete contract cost. They should. Solar is a significant acquisition. Still, raw cost alone can be misleading.
Two systems with comparable panel counts may vary due to the fact that one includes a primary panel upgrade, attic channel runs, pest guard, keeping track of setup, and more powerful handiwork protection. One more might look less expensive because essential items are left out or due to the fact that the funding structure spreads out costs in a manner that conceals the real system price.
Cash purchases, fundings, leases, and power purchase arrangements all alter how worth needs to be judged. A low month-to-month repayment can be attained by extending term size or embedding costs right into financing. That does not make it a poor choice for every home owner, but it does indicate you need to contrast equivalent numbers.
A useful means to evaluate proposals is to ask each company to present the cash money cost, funding terms, estimated first-year production, and what is included in creating. Once those numbers are on the table, contrasts become much more honest.
If your roofing is near completion of its life, solar may require to wait. I know homeowners do not enjoy hearing that, especially after spending time on quotes, however eliminating and reinstalling a solar selection later is costly and disruptive.
A responsible installer will certainly not rush past this point. They will certainly analyze roofing age, material, and noticeable condition. On asphalt tile roof coverings, if you are within several years of replacement, it is worth discussing roofing first. On ceramic tile roofs, the discussion might shift toward underlayment condition, delicacy, and the ability of staffs working around floor tile. On facility roofing systems with numerous penetrations, flashing high quality ends up being much more important.
This is where trust turns up once more. Good installers are willing to shed a sale today to stay clear of a bad task tomorrow. That sincerity has a tendency to conserve home owners money.
Storage has actually ended up being a much larger component of the solar conversation, and forever reason. Some home owners want backup power for failures. Others want even more control over just how they utilize solar energy, especially if energy price frameworks make self-consumption extra valuable.
Still, a battery is not instantly the ideal add-on. It raises task expense dramatically, and not every household requires full-home backup. In some cases a partial back-up approach covering refrigeration, internet, some lighting, and a few circuits is the better fit. In some cases property owners choose solar now and leave the system battery-ready for later.
A great installer should walk you through actual use instances. If your main problem is maintaining clinical equipment, garage gain access to, and food refrigeration online throughout interruptions, that is a various battery layout than attempting to run central air for extensive periods. System sizing need to follow your demands, not the other way around.

Solar warranty language is frequently misinterpreted. Tools warranties usually originate from the maker. Workmanship guarantees originate from the installer. Roofing infiltration warranties might be individually specified. Those differences matter due to the fact that the procedure for getting assistance depends upon who is responsible.
Ask that you call initially if outcome declines suddenly. Ask what solution action appears like. Ask whether labor for service warranty substitutes is covered. Ask how surveillance alerts are handled, and whether a person is really evaluating them or if the problem falls totally on you.
The dry run is simple: if an inverter fails 6 years from currently, will you understand precisely who to contact, and do you think they will still be there? Strong local firms usually win on this factor, also if they are not the cheapest bid. Integrity after setup has genuine value.
A solar variety must fit the home, not an abstract standard. Previous utility costs issue, however future modifications matter also. If a household anticipates to add an electric vehicle, button to a heatpump, install a pool heating system, or create a home office, current usage may understate future demand.
Likewise, large systems are not always the answer. Relying on neighborhood utility regulations, overproducing far past yearly usage may not supply in proportion monetary return. This is one more location where knowledgeable modeling issues. The best solar installment firms near me will not just try to make the most of panel count. They will certainly speak with use patterns, spending plan, and anticipated repayment in reasonable terms.
An excellent sizing conversation must really feel specific to your family. If it does not, the proposition is probably too generic.
Many home owners assume installation day is the main event. It is important, but it is just one action. A task can relocate quickly on the roof and afterwards sit in a line for assessment or utility authorization. That is frustrating if nobody described the process upfront.
Competent installers established assumptions early. They will generally define the series in plain language: style completion, allow entry, installment scheduling, community examination, energy approval, and authorization to run. They might not be able to guarantee exact dates, due to the fact that some steps rely on agencies outside their control, yet they need to be able to explain the likely rhythm of the job.
That sort of interaction is particularly important if you are planning around traveling, roof covering replacement, re-finance timing, or a major home task. The distinction between a three-week hold-up and a three-month surprise commonly boils down to exactly how positive the installer is.
